Apple Sweet Potato Scallop

This is the perfect side dish on a chilly Autumn evening. The apples give it just the right amount of sweetness, and it smells heavenly cooking. I actually cooked this in a smaller oval casserole dish and used 2 sweet potatoes and 3 apples, so obviously the amounts are very flexible. Just reduce the other ingredients and make sure you use enough OJ so that it covers about 2/3 of the sweet potatoes and apples. Yum! I got this wonderful recipe from my friend Shell Marr.

Ingredients

6 Apples, peeled and sliced (if your apples are small you
May want
at Least one more)
6 Sweet potatoes, peeled and sliced
1 cup Orange juice
1 Grated orange, zest of
1 teaspoon Cinnamon
1 cup Crushed corn flakes or breadcrumbs
Nonstick cooking spray

Preparation

1. Spray a 9x13-inch baking dish with non-stick cooking

spray.

2. Place alternate layers of sweet potatoes and apples in

baking

dish, ending with apples.

3. Pour orange juice and zest over mixture and sprinkle

with cinnamon.

4. Bake, covered with foil, in preheated 375 degree oven

for 40 minutes.

5. Remove foil, top with crushed cereal or bread crumbs,

and spray

with non-stick cooking spray.

6. Bake 15 to 20 minutes more until brown.
